TSN and NHL insider Bob McKenzie is well-known for his deep analysis of the NHL Entry Draft for many years now.
For the 2022 Draft, his "final" rankings come as a bit of a surprise, with just over a week to go before round one starts next Thursday.
"The headline will be that it's the first time this season — that includes pre-season rankings in September; mid-season rankings in January; draft lottery edition rankings in April; and now the final rankings in June — that someone other than Wright is No. 1."
According to the insider, out of 10 NHL scouts, four had Wright going first and five had Slafkovsky (no report on who else got a first place vote).
The Slovakian was ranked number five at mid-season but thanks to two stellar international performances at the Olympics and the men's world championship, he has propelled himself all the way up to number one.
Per Slafkovsky's scouting report on why he would be taken ahead of Wright:
"What separates Slafkovsky from Wright for me is that he's bigger, he played harder, he was more consistent with his competitiveness, and he stepped up to produce on big stages [Olympics and world championship],» another NHL head scout said. «In my view, he has the best chance to be a first-line NHL forward."
